The Routine
A six-step process we follow on every Buckeye pool, whether it sits on a golf lot in Verrado or a new cul-de-sac off Watson Road. Here is exactly what our technician does at your house.
We inspect the pump, filter, heater, automation, and pool surface first, looking for leaks, unusual sounds, weak flow, scale, and staining before anything else happens.
ποΈ Buckeye's groundwater leaves scale on salt cells and heater exchangers faster than city water elsewhere, so both get close attention every visit.
Surface skimming, full brushing of walls and steps, vacuuming as needed, and emptying both baskets. This is the step that keeps algae from ever getting a start.
π΅ Dust off the Buckeye Valley fields and the open desert around Sun Valley Parkway settles into pools daily, so brushing and vacuuming are never skipped.
Chlorine, pH, alkalinity, calcium hardness, cyanuric acid, and salt where applicable are tested every visit and dosed precisely. Balanced water protects plaster, equipment, and swimmers.
π§ With Buckeye's naturally high calcium and magnesium levels, hardness and alkalinity get extra scrutiny to keep scale off tile and plaster.
We check filter pressure, run the automation cycle, confirm heater operation, and listen to the pump for strain so small issues are caught before they become expensive.
βοΈ Buckeye sits low and hot, and pumps run long hours here. We watch seals and bearings closely before a small noise becomes a full replacement.
Waterline tile wiped, coping joints cleared, and the deck rinsed around the skimmers. These details separate a serviced pool from a beautifully maintained one.
π§½ Calcium scale builds quickly on Buckeye tile, so we knock it back a little every visit instead of letting it turn into a bead-blasting job.
Before leaving, we send a note with chemistry readings, what was done, anything to keep an eye on, and any recommendations. You never wonder whether we came.

Weekly, year round. Buckeye's high-mineral groundwater will scale tile and salt cells if chemistry drifts for even a couple of weeks, dust from the surrounding farmland and desert settles into pools constantly, and summer evaporation is heavy at this elevation. Heated pools, spas, and homes on the edge of open desert often benefit from a second weekly visit during peak season.
Most Buckeye pools land between $150 and $250 per month for full weekly maintenance, including chemicals, brushing, vacuuming, and basket cleaning. Size, equipment, and current condition set the exact price. Filter cleanings are flat-rate and quoted up front, and repairs are always quoted before any work starts.
Most Buckeye pools clear in three to five days. Our green-to-clean process shocks, balances, brushes, and filters until the water is safe to swim in, and we rarely need to drain, which matters in a city that manages its groundwater carefully and where an empty pool can bake in the sun during refill.
